Returns an angle between -90 and 90 degrees whose tangent is equal to the number specified. Category Math Syntax Result = ArcTan( Number ); Parameter Number Any number or numeric attribute. Examples ArcTan(1); ' returns 45 ArcTan(0); ' returns 0 See also ArcCos() ArcSin() Cos() Sin() Tan()
